Programs and Curriculum

Trinity offers a variety of preschool and Kindergarten programs and an extended day program for children enrolled in the school.

All children entering Trinity’s preschool or Kindergarten program must be the appropriate age by September 1. Children enrolling in the “Mommy and Me” program must be two by December 31. Hours for the morning session are 9:00 a.m. – 12:00 noon. All children entering our Three-Year-Old program must be potty-trained.

The School Year

The preschool program begins in September with conferences and a gradual entrance program. This is designed to provide a supportive and successful introduction to the preschool environment. The Kindergarten program begins in late August to allow for the required 170 school days. The school year extends through May.

Trinity offers three programs for our two-year-olds. The Mommy & Me class meets one day per week and requires that each child be accompanied by a parent or significant adult. The program provides opportunities for you and your child to have fun together while participating in age appropriate activities planned by the teacher.

The Explorers is our drop-off program for two-year-olds. Your child may attend a 2-day or 3-day program under the supervision of a classroom teacher and an assistant. This program provides the children with the opportunity to separate from their parent or caregiver in a very gentle manner and at the same time gain a level of comfort in a classroom setting.

Both Mommy & Me and Trinity Explorers provide opportunities for children to interact with their peers while learning to share and take turns. Craft activities, free play and circle time with songs, stories and fingerplays are included in the programs.

Programs for three year olds provide readiness activities, art/craft experiences and opportunities for socialization so important at this age. Trinity offers 3 Three-Year-Old programs. Your child can attend a 2-day, 3-day or five-day program.

Four Year Olds

Trinity offers two programs for four-year-olds. Your child may attend the three or five day program. The curriculum includes a reading readiness program entitled, “Little Treasures” and a math program entitled, “Math Connects.” The reading readiness program is an integrated curriculum that includes math, science and social studies. Spanish instruction is incorporated into the Pre-K program as well. An afternoon Enrichment Program is available for our four-year-olds. The Enrichment Program has been designed to help children make the transition from Pre-K into a full-day Kindergarten program. Children remain in school for an additional three hours on Monday, Wednesday and Friday extending their day until 3:00 P.M. The focus of the afternoon session is hands-on science and social studies activities designed to improve language, pre-reading, and writing skills. A thirty minute lunch period is included with appropriate time set aside for outdoor play and rest.

Trinity’s Kindergarten provides reading instruction using an integrated program entitled, “Treasures”. The reading program includes a literature component, direct phonics instruction, math, science and social studies. It is one of the five reading programs approved by MSDE. Additionally, our Kindergarten program uses Saxon Math, which provides a hands-on approach to math instruction. Kindergartners are also offered Spanish instruction.

Trinity also offers a Kindergarten Enrichment program. Kindergarten Enrichment extends the day for Kindergarten children until 3 o’clock. It is an optional program designed to provide a nurturing, learning environment promoting exploration, creativity, literacy, and social skills. The program has been developed to enrich and enhance the regular Kindergarten program with emphasis in the areas of science, social studies, language arts, and creative writing. Parents have an option of choosing either three or five additional afternoons. A thirty minute lunch period is included with appropriate time for rest and outdoor play.

Extended Days/Lunch Bunch

The Extended Day program operates from 8:00 a.m. to 9:00 a.m. and 12:00 noon to 5:30 p.m. Monday through Friday for regular or occasional care. Lunch Bunch extends the school day until 1:00 p.m. for additional playtime and the convenience of parents. Trinity’s Extended Day program and Lunch Bunch are available to all children who are three-years-old and are potty trained. Our Extended Day program is licensed by the Maryland State Department of Education/Early Childhood Development Office.
